About AI Training and Document Evaluation

AI systems learn from examples prepared and reviewed by people. In document-focused projects, subject-matter experts assess whether materials are accurate, complete, clear, compliant, and useful, then provide feedback that helps improve model performance.

This work brings corporate accounting expertise into a fast-growing technology field. Prior AI training experience can help, but accounting expertise is central to this role and prior AI experience is not required.

The Role

OpenTrain is recruiting a Corporate Accounting AI Training Reviewer to apply corporate accounting expertise to AI training work. You will review and assess financial materials, audit practices, financial models, tax documentation, and related legal documents.

The role combines senior accounting judgment with hands-on evaluation and annotation. Your assessments will focus on accuracy, completeness, compliance, practical value, and actionable feedback across business scenarios.

What You'll Do

You will contribute careful written and verbal analysis while supporting the development and evaluation of datasets used for AI training. The work requires independent judgment as well as effective collaboration with cross-functional teams.

  • Review and annotate financial reports and statements against established accounting standards.
  • Evaluate audit procedures, identify gaps and best practices, and consider regulatory implications across business scenarios.
  • Create and assess financial models for logical structure, accuracy, and actionable insights.
  • Analyze tax compliance practices and documentation, highlighting risks and compliance issues.
  • Review legal and financial documents for clarity, correctness, and regulatory alignment.
  • Deliver constructive written and verbal feedback on project materials.
  • Support the development and evaluation of datasets for AI training.

Why Work in AI Training

AI training is the human side of building artificial intelligence. Professionals review examples, evaluate outputs, and provide specialized feedback so modern AI systems can perform more reliably in areas such as finance, compliance, and document analysis.

The work is remote and flexible, making it possible to contribute from anywhere with an internet connection while applying expertise to the development of state-of-the-art AI.
